The Detex DT-018 Key Cover Lock Detex Ecl405 Dt018 is a precision-engineered component designed for high-security cylinder locks in commercial security applications. Crafted from durable brass, this replacement key cover measures 1 7/8 inches (48 mm) in length and 7/8 inches (22 mm) in width, offering reliable fitment on Fmp# 134-1163 cylinder locks. It is used primarily with emergency alarm systems, notably on model 134-1041, providing key retention and protection within security setups. The Detex DT-018 is a compact, OEM-grade brass key cover, with dimensions of 1 7/8 inches (48 mm) in length, 7/8 inches (22 mm) wide, and a height of 0.25 inches. Weighing only 0.02 lbs, it features a straightforward design optimized for quick installation on Fmp# 134-1163 cylinder locks found in emergency alarm systems. The part originates from the United States, ensuring high manufacturing standards, and is compatible across various security hardware setups.
